What it proves
CRISPRa single and pair perturbation design can be calibrated in a public single-cell method reference.
single cell · Single-cell gene expression
What it cannot prove
It cannot support muscle/DMD overexpression claims or infer combination benefit for current candidates.
Dataset value is task-specific; no Dataset Card alone is evidence of candidate efficacy, patient response or clinical utility.
Best model use
Use for activation-design and pair-task calibration outside the DMD biological claim space.
Calibrate activation and combination task design
Next experiment handoff
Move activation or pair hypotheses into a muscle/DMD-specific assay before interpreting biological effect.
